How to Make Homemade Love Spell Soap:

  1. Cut your soap base into small cubes and place into your microwave safe measuring cup.
  2. Microwave for 30 seconds then remove and stir. Repeat this process until all the soap is melted.
  3. Add your mica. Keep in mind it will look a little clumpy so just continue to stir and stir until it is well mixed. You can also spray the top with a little isopropyl alcohol and it will help break up the clumps.love spell soap step1
  4. Add the love spell fragrance oil. You will only need about 5-6 drops depending on how strong you want the scent to be. Stir well.love spell soap step2
  5. Pour the melted soap base into the cavities of your heart mold. Tip: Place a cutting board under the mold to help support it while the soap hardens.love spell soap step3
  6. Spray the tops of the soaps with isopropyl alcohol to remove any air bubbles that made their way to surface.
  7. Now allow the soap to harden for about 5-6 hours (overnight is best) before removing from the mold. To remove, simply gently press the backside of the mold and the soaps will pop right out.
  8. Soaps can be used immediately or wrapped in plastic wrap for future use.

I also want to mention that the speckled look in my final soap wasn’t exactly intentional. It was some of the mica left over that didn’t mix but it’s entirely safe to use and I think it gives the soap a bit of character. 🙂
